Careful-Use Notes
While the Silhouette of a Dragon is visually stunning, there are some considerations for production:
- Dense Stitch Areas: The dragon's body may have dense stitching, so using the right stabilizer is essential to prevent puckering.
- Tiny Details: Since the design is a silhouette, there are no tiny details to worry about, which is a plus for larger fabric surfaces.
- Thick Fabric: The design works well on thick fabrics like denim or canvas, but adjustments may be needed for very textured materials.
- Dark Fabric: To maintain visibility, ensure the thread color contrasts well with dark fabrics.
- Curved Surfaces: When applying to curved surfaces like caps, a proper hoop size and stabilizer will help keep the design intact.
- Small Sizes: While the silhouette remains clear even when scaled down, it’s best to review spacing and hoop size for smaller applications.

Embroidery Designer Tips
Before turning the Silhouette of a Dragon into craft fair products, here are a few professional tips:
- Test on Scrap Fabric: Always test the embroidery file on scrap fabric to ensure it stitches correctly and looks as intended.
- Check Thread Contrast: Ensure the thread colors used match the fabric to maintain the design's impact.
- Review Spacing: Adjust the design’s spacing if necessary, especially for smaller or curved surfaces.
- Confirm Hoop Size: Use the correct hoop size to avoid distortion during stitching.
- Inspect Stitch Density: Check for areas where stitch density might affect the fabric’s integrity.
- Use the Right Stabilizer: Choose a stabilizer that matches the fabric type to prevent puckering or stretching.
- Create a Real Mockup: Make at least one real sample to evaluate the design in person before mass production.
- Compare Fabric Colors: Different fabric colors can change how the design appears, so compare options before finalizing.
- Confirm Commercial Licensing: If selling finished products, confirm the embroidery file has the appropriate commercial license.
